一、代码如下:
import java.io.IOException;
import java.text.SimpleDateFormat;
import java.util.Date;
import javax.crypto.Cipher;
import javax.crypto.SecretKey;
import javax.crypto.SecretKeyFactory;
import javax.crypto.spec.DESKeySpec;
import javax.crypto.spec.IvParameterSpec;
import javax.crypto.spec.SecretKeySpec;
import org.apache.commons.net.util.Base64;
import sun.misc.BASE64Decoder;
public class Decrypt {
private static SimpleDateFormat dateFormat;
/** 安全密钥 */
//private static String keyData = "ABCDEFGHIJKLMNOPQRSTWXYZabcdefghijklmnopqrstwxyz0123456789-_.";
private static String keyData = "20190809";
public synchronized static String formatAll(Date date,String timeType) {
dateFormat=new SimpleDateFormat(timeType);
return dateFormat.format(date);
}
public synchronized static Date formatDate(String date,String timeType)throws Exception {
dateFormat=new SimpleDateFormat(timeType);
return dateFormat.parse(date);
}
//static Simpl

最低0.47元/天 解锁文章
1326

被折叠的 条评论
为什么被折叠?



